Can you cut a slab that's already poured?
Yes — that's most of what saw-cutting is. We cut expansion joints in fresh pours and demo cuts in slabs for renovations or plumbing.
How deep can you cut?
Standard cut is 1/4 of slab depth for control joints. Full-depth cuts up to about 6″ for demo work with our walk-behind saw.
